PRODUCT OVERVIEW:

What makes this product different?
The UQL6473 brings a sculptural, nature-inspired touch with its petal-like crystal glass shades that mimic a blooming flower—offering a more artistic silhouette than typical wall sconces. Crafted with a sturdy matte black steel frame, it contrasts delicate glasswork with bold structure. Where many fixtures in this category use plain frosted or clear globes, this design introduces artisanal textures that refract light into a radiant, warm glow, elevating both traditional and modern interiors.

COLLECTION DESCRIPTION:

The Moline Collection combines bold structure with delicate beauty, featuring a striking metal frame and sculpted glass shades that resemble blooming petals. The contrast between the sturdy frame and the elegant, translucent glass creates a balanced design that feels both timeless and artistic. Ideal for dining rooms, foyers, or statement walls, this fixture adds a refined yet organic touch, casting a soft, radiant glow that enhances any space with elegance and warmth.The Moline Collection has a bold, sculptural design with a nature-inspired touch. The chandelier and wall sconce feature petal-like crystal shades arranged in a blooming pattern, creating a striking visual effect. The chandelier has a sturdy metal frame with gracefully curved arms supporting multiple crystal shades, while the wall sconce extends from a sleek, tapered arm anchored to a round backplate. The textured crystal refracts light beautifully, adding warmth and elegance. With its mix of organic form and structured metal, the collection makes a statement in both modern and classic interiors.Available in chandeliers and wall sconces, this collection features matte black and brushed gold metal finishes.
